<title>Abstract</title> <p> Snijders Blok-Campeau Syndrome (SNIBCPS) is a rare neurodevelopmental disorder caused by mutations in the <italic>CHD3</italic> gene. Here, we report a <italic>de novo</italic> single-nucleotide variant (c.C3073T, p.R1025W) in <italic>CHD3</italic> identified in a child with SNIBCPS, which leads to accelerated degradation of the CHD3 protein.
